Greetings,
I had some discussions with Karen about a race that was in the
ObjectMonitor::enter() code in CR2/v2.02/5-for-jdk13. This race was
theoretical and I had no test failures due to it. The fix is pretty
simple: remove the special case code for async deflation in the
ObjectMonitor::enter() function and rely solely on the ref_count
for ObjectMonitor::enter() protection.
During those discussions Karen also floated the idea of using the
ref_count field instead of the contentions field for the Async
Monitor Deflation protocol. I decided to go ahead and code up that
change and I have run it through the usual stress and Mach5 testing
with no issues. It's also known as v2.03 (for those for with the
patches) and as webrev/6-for-jdk13 (for those with webrev URLs).
Sorry for all the names...

This version of the patch has been thru Mach5 tier[1-8] testing on
Oracle's usual set of platforms. My Solaris-X64 stress kit run had
no issues. Kitchensink8H on product, fastdebug, and slowdebug bits
had no failures on Linux-X64; MacOSX fastdebug and slowdebug and
Solaris-X64 release had the usual "Too large time diff" complaints.
12 hour Inflate2 runs on product, fastdebug and slowdebug bits on
Linux-X64, MacOSX and Solaris-X64 had no failures. My Linux-X64
stress kit is running right now.
I've done the SPECjbb2015 baseline and CR3 runs. I need to gather
the results and analyze them.
